    The study analyzed patient acceptance of telerehabilitation services in Germany using the UTAUT2 framework.

  • 2

    Data was collected from 230 participants across thirteen rehabilitation centers, measuring factors like usability and technology affinity.

  • 3

    High acceptance of telerehabilitation was reported, with significant influences from performance expectancy, habit, and hedonic motivation.

  • 4

    The relationship between behavioral intention and actual use behavior was not statistically supported, indicating an intention-behavior gap.

  • 5

    The UTAUT2 model demonstrated good explanatory power for behavioral intention but limited power for use behavior.
